    Please report (list / register) any paint problems you have had while using LD in this thread. Include a photo where able, the Loco or Car affected, the Route it belongs, what the exact problem is, and your Platform.

    The example below shall serve as the first registered issues...

    Peninsula Corridor, GP38-2,
    Multiple items as follows:
    1) Unable to paint a corner of the unit as shown below.
    p3.jpg

    2) Doors do not take paint.
    The blue doors in this image are part of the base colour while the grey is the layer.
    They do not take cover layers.

    p4.jpg

    3) Numbers unpaintable / unchangeable.
    This is a problem on many units that should be rectified for full customization as has been reported and mentioned by many gamers over the years. They make for stupid looking custom liveries...
    p1.jpg

    Summary:

    Loco - GP38-2
    Route - Peninsula Corridor
    Platform - Xbox 1 S
    Various known issues to date.

    Further to the above re: numbers:
    When painted the loco was 503, now randomly spawns in game as 504. See images below.
    As painted...
    n3.jpg

    In game...
    n5.jpeg
    Same with the other reskin...
    n1.jpeg
    Both reskins were painted as 503 in LD to match the given numbers.

    *Notes: Number boards seem to be a problem on multiple units from multiple routes in multiple ways. Either unpaintable, spawning incorrectly, or over-riding re-numberings by creators (as in Clinchfield)
    Also, creators should have more control over numbers AND the ability to run multiple units with different numbers instead of twins or triplets with the same numbers. Not sure how this could be done aside from creating multiple separate numbered reskinned units, but the ability to choose units in timetable or scenario planner (or a consist editor) when running more than a single unit would be a huge step in the right direction.
